What is MedAll?
MedAll is a comprehensive healthcare training platform designed for universal accessibility, offering specialized features for healthcare teams, societies, and hospital departments. The platform facilitates fair medical education through a robust suite of resources including events, videos, question banks, and community-building tools. MedAll's mission is to empower healthcare professionals, students, and teams by providing a centralized hub for educational content, event hosting, and professional networking. How much funding has MedAll raised?
MedAll has raised a total of $3.4M across 1 funding round:
Angel/Seed
$3.4M
Angel/Seed (2022): $3.4M with participation from Connect Ventures, Nina Capital, and Sarah Friar
Key Investors in MedAll
Connect Ventures
Connect Ventures is a London-based venture firm specializing in pre-seed and seed stage product companies, known for its entrepreneur-friendly approach and support for founders in achieving product-market fit.
Nina Capital
Nina Capital is a venture capital firm focused on health technology, providing capital to need-driven founders aiming to transform healthcare through information technology at the pre-seed and seed stages.
